Hey everyone, I'll get this started with my own car. It's not very good looking since I wanted to work on performance modifications before cosmetic ones. I'm slowly improving the exterior appearance now, but it's clearly not a show car. The car's been slowly accumulating mods over the past couple years and as it sits it has a built/swapped motor, swapped driveline and modified brakes/suspension/etc. I'm just going to start off with a list of mods currently on the car (off the top of my head and probably not all inclusive) I'll also be including info on the new motor. Feel free to comment

Exterior:
-2002 wingless Platinum Silver Metallic WRX sedan
-Debadged (except for Impreza tag)
-Blacked out headlights

Interior:
-Schroth Rallye 3 harnasses
- EGT/Boost/oil pres. gauges
-PLX devises Wideband AFR
-Kartboy shiftknob
-Gizzmo Electronics 2 stage shiftlight and Launch control
-Momo racing wheel with quick disconnect
-indicator LEDs for Center differential and Methanol injection
-Control unit for AEM meth injection system

Engine/Driveline:
-V7 JDM STI semi closed deck block casing
-V8 JDM STI crank (nitrided and balanced to 10k+ rpms)
-V8 JDM STI rods
-.020 over Wiseco forged pistons
-Calico coatings Moly coated race bearings (crank and rods)
-JDM V5 STI big port heads/cams, Mild port/polish
-ARP headstuds
-modified JDM high flow Dual AVCS pump
-Rotated mount Uppipe and Downpipe (custom made)
-unequal length headers
-Tial 38mm wastegate plumbed to Downpipe
-PTE SC61 turbo .63AR, 4inch antisurge compressor housing with ported 2.5inch outlet (custom built with a few top secret goodies, rated to 650bhp)
-Tial 50mm BOV
-Greddy Kevlar timing belt
-FMIC
-Fuel rails
-820cc injectors
-Walbro 255lph fuel pump
-Haste 3 core polished aluminum race radiator
-Samco coolant hoses
-Optima Redtop battery
-KS tech maf flange for custom MAF
-Southbend dual friction STI clutch
-STI flywheel
-STI Group N engine mounts
-STI Group N transmission mounts
-Kartboy rear Diff bushings
-Perrin shifter bushings
-Stock ECU reflash (100% self tuned with romraider software)
-Gizzmo Electronics Launch control interface
-GM 3 port boost control solenoid (homemade scramble boost coming soon)
-Borla Hush 3inch catback
-AEM methanol injection system
-2004 USDM STI 6speed transmission
-Sti driveshaft
-STI R180 rear differential
-Driveshaft Shop Level 5 rear axles
-DCCDpro center differential controller

Suspension/Brakes:
-Megan Racing Track coilovers (fully adjustable 12k/10k rates)
-Strut tower bars
-Racing brake brand slotted rotors with improved cooling fin design front
-Racing brake legacy H6 rear big brake conversion
-Carbotech Panther XP8+ track pads front and rear
-Stainless goodridge brake lines
-ATE Superblue fluid
-rear camber bolts
-Underbody H-brace (not currently installed)


Wheels/Tires:

Track: Rota G-force 18x9 with 285 width Hoosiers
Summer: Stock wheels with 225 Dunlop Z1 star specs
Winter: Stock with Bridgestone Winterforce tires

Thanks! Interestingly, it didn't cost a ton to do. Well, the performance stuff at least, the trans swap bled my wallet dry. One of my major goals was to make "big" power on a budget, so I made a lot of the parts myself and did 100% of the labor and tuning (with the help of a couple friends for heavy lifting, etc.).

I actually ended up making my own rotated mount uppipe, downpipe and EWG plumbing, made most of the IC piping myself from generic tubing.

Here is my BMW E30. I picked it up over a year ago, with blown up engine and no reverse. After numerous weekends I got this thing running. I wanted to have inexpensive club racing car that I could drive to and from a track. I got welded in roll cage, race suspension, all adjustable camber/caster/toe front and rear,fully gutted out interior, engine management, LSD, upgraded brakes, exhaust (side dumb), fully rebuild race engine. Car is under 2100lb!
I am planing on making a turbo kit and fuel cell before next season.
